Check out these stunning photos of Malta’s underground Mercieca reservoir in Ta' Qali
The following photos taken by Steven Mallia show the astounding and enormous Mercieca reservoir found in Ta’ Qali. This reservoir has recently been restored and cleaned back to its former glory.
The reservoir is over 419m2 and holds an impressive 26,180,000 litres of water.
Originally, the primary water source for this reservoir was the Wignacourt springs. However, now that the reservoir has been restored, it is now connected to the Pembroke Reverse Osmosis pipeline through a 9.5km long tunnel.
An old photo of the reservoir was also posted showing many workers during a hard day’s work as they built this historically unique structure.
